Gauff's Dominant First Set

Gauff started the match with an impressive display of power and precision, dominating the first set against Zheng. Her serve was a particularly potent weapon, consistently hitting strong aces and consistently placing her serves to exploit weaknesses in Zheng's return game. The Italian Open crowd was enthralled by Gauff's aggressive baseline play, characterized by deep, penetrating groundstrokes that kept Zheng on the defensive. This early control translated into a decisive break of serve, giving Gauff the momentum she needed.

  • Strong serve percentage: Gauff consistently landed first serves above 60%, significantly hindering Zheng's ability to return effectively.
  • Early break of serve: A crucial break in the fourth game set the tone for the entire set, showcasing Gauff's aggressive approach.
  • Aggressive baseline play: Gauff dictated rallies with powerful groundstrokes, rarely giving Zheng an opportunity to take control of the point.
  • Limited unforced errors: Gauff displayed remarkable control and precision, minimizing mistakes and maintaining a high level of consistency.

Zheng's Resurgence in the Second Set

After a dominant first set from Gauff, Qinwen Zheng demonstrated remarkable resilience and fighting spirit, staging a stunning comeback in the second set. Zheng significantly improved her return of serve, putting more pressure on Gauff and forcing her into longer rallies. She employed a more varied game plan, utilizing drop shots effectively to disrupt Gauff's rhythm and create openings. This tactical shift, combined with consistently winning crucial points on Gauff's serve, enabled her to level the match.

  • Improved return of serve: Zheng’s return game became far more aggressive and effective, consistently putting Gauff on the back foot.
  • More aggressive approach at the net: Zheng successfully moved forward to the net to finish points on several occasions.
  • Winning crucial points on Gauff's serve: This was vital in breaking down Gauff's dominance from the first set.
  • Successful use of drop shots: These effectively disrupted Gauff's rhythm and opened up opportunities for winners.

Gauff's Decisive Third Set

The final set showcased the mental strength and composure of Coco Gauff. Despite Zheng's impressive comeback, Gauff remained focused and determined, maintaining her consistent baseline play under immense pressure. The American teenager displayed incredible resilience, holding her serve in crucial games to prevent any momentum swings from going Zheng's way. Gauff's clinical finishing of points and ability to capitalize on any opportunity presented further demonstrated her championship caliber. This match highlighted her incredible mental fortitude on the big stage.

  • Consistent baseline play under pressure: Gauff maintained her powerful groundstrokes even with the increased pressure of the final set.
  • Important hold of serve in crucial games: This prevented Zheng from gaining any momentum and turned the tide in Gauff's favor.
  • Clinical finishing of points: Gauff demonstrated a ruthless efficiency in closing out points, capitalizing on any minor error from Zheng.
  • Demonstration of mental fortitude: Gauff's mental resilience was crucial in overcoming Zheng's resurgence.

Match Statistics and Key Highlights

The final score of the Gauff vs. Zheng Italian Open semifinal was 6-4, 4-6, 6-2. While precise statistics vary across different reporting sources, Gauff demonstrated a higher percentage of first serves in, more aces, and fewer double faults compared to Zheng. A key highlight was Gauff's crucial break in the final set to take a 5-2 lead; this ultimately sealed her victory.
